How much do cardiothoracic surgery j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 12, 2026, the average yearly pay for cardiothoracic surgery in Raleigh, NC is $219,772.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$169,600.00 and $262,400.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are some common challenges cardiothoracic surgeons face when working as part of a multidisciplinary team?

Cardiothoracic surgeons often collaborate closely with anesthesiologists, nurses, perfusionists, and other specialists, which can present challenges in communication and coordination, especially during complex procedures. Ensuring everyone is aligned on the surgical plan and patient care protocols is crucial for successful outcomes. Additionally, surgeons must balance leadership with teamwork, adapting to different working styles and maintaining clear, respectful communication under high-pressure situations. These challenges are typically addressed through regular team meetings, debriefings, and ongoing professional development in communication skills.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in cardiothoracic surgery?

To thrive in Cardiothoracic Surgery, you need extensive surgical training, board certification, and in-depth knowledge of cardiac and thoracic anatomy and procedures. Mastery of advanced surgical instruments, cardiopulmonary bypass machines, and familiarity with imaging technologies is crucial. Exceptional hand-eye coordination, decision-making under pressure, and teamwork are standout soft skills in this role. These competencies are vital to ensuring patient safety, successful outcomes, and effective collaboration in high-stakes surgical environments.

What is the difference between Cardiothoracic Surgery vs Cardiovascular Surgery?

AspectCardiothoracic SurgeryCardiovascular Surgery
CredentialsMedical degree, surgical residency, board certification in cardiothoracic surgeryMedical degree, surgical residency, board certification in cardiovascular surgery
Work EnvironmentOperating rooms, hospitals, clinicsOperating rooms, specialized cardiac centers, hospitals
Industry UsagePerforms surgeries on heart, lungs, esophagusFocuses specifically on heart and blood vessel surgeries

Cardiothoracic surgeons perform surgeries involving the heart, lungs, and chest, while cardiovascular surgeons specialize specifically in heart and blood vessel procedures. Both roles require similar credentials and work environments, but their focus areas differ, with cardiothoracic surgeons having a broader scope.

What is cardiothoracic surgery?

Cardiothoracic surgery is a specialized field of medicine focused on the surgical treatment of diseases affecting the heart, lungs, esophagus, and other organs within the chest (thorax). Cardiothoracic surgeons perform a variety of procedures, including coronary artery bypass grafting, heart valve repair or replacement, lung resections, and surgeries to correct congenital heart defects. These surgeries can be life-saving and often require highly advanced techniques and technology. Cardiothoracic surgeons work as part of a team that may include anesthesiologists, nurses, and other specialists to provide comprehensive care for their patients.

Services:

Cardiac Surgery service with a focus on highly complex patients with coronary artery disease, structural heart abnormalities, and heart failure.

The focus of this position is centered around first or second assisting during Cardiac Surgery

EVH system: Hemopro 2

Busy Mechanical Circulatory Support (MCS) program including LVAD, ECMO, and Impella

Participates in collaborative procedures with Cardiology such as TAVRs, TMVRs, MitraClips

May participate in education and training programs hosted by the service, including surgical resident, medical student, and PA student training.
